Electrochemical preparation and characterization of Ni/SiC compositionally graded multilayered coatings

Reads0
Chats0
TLDR
In this paper, Ni/SiC functionally graded composite coatings have been obtained by electrochemical deposition of silicon carbide microparticles (mean diameter 2 μm) from nickel Watts baths with different concentrations of SiC particles in solution.
